Yahoo Local Web Search

Search results

  1. Word of Life Christian ChurchChurch

    Phone: (314) 533-3849

    Cross Streets: Between Rosalie St and Fair Ave

    4131 E Carter Ave St Louis, MO 63115 397.78 mi

    Is this your business? Verify your listing